I just wanted to post a note about city naming, especially in the Lower Mainland.

Per the wiki, cities should NOT have the province identifier in them. So, the following are good:
Vancouver
Abbotsford
Burnaby

While these aren’t:
Vancouver, BC
Abbotsford, BC
Burnaby, British Columbia

Unfortunately, there are two cities whose names seem to conflict with others in Canada: Port Moody and Maple Ridge.

These two should get the “, BC” after them:
Port Moody, BC
Maple Ridge, BC

but only until we can get the Waze staff to resolve this.

I also see that “British Columbia” is available to the drop down “state” box, does this remove the need for the adding of BC in the city name field?

Yes indeed.
Use the “state” option and do-not write the state-name in the city line.
